On the origin and diversification of Podolian cattle breeds: testing scenarios of European colonization using genome-wide SNP data.

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: During the Neolithic expansion, cattle accompanied humans and spread from their domestication centres to colonize the ancient world. In addition, European cattle occasionally intermingled with both indicine cattle and local aurochs resulting in an exclusive pattern of genetic diversity.
